The Motorcyclist's Wind Protection Guide

At highway speeds, wind noise inside a motorcycle helmet routinely exceeds 100 dB. This is loud enough to cause permanent tinnitus and hearing damage in under 15 minutes. Motorcycling earplugs require extremely short, soft stems that don't rub against helmet liners, combined with filters that target wind scream while preserving engine and intercom audibility.

1. Wind Noise vs. Sirens

Motorcyclists must not isolate themselves completely from road hazards. Filtered plugs target high-frequency wind drag screech while allowing mid-frequency sirens, vehicle horns, and GPS intercoms to remain audible.

2. Helmet Clearance

Long stems or bulky polymer custom caps will rub against helmet cheek pads. This not only causes painful friction but can break the acoustic ear seal, letting wind screeches in. Look for short, flexible stems.

3. Sweat & Material Durability

Long rides in helmets trigger sweat and heat. Materials like medical TPE (which adapts to canal shapes using ear heat) or hypoallergenic silicone resist moisture and can be washed easily after dusty tours.
